You Are Made in God’s Image

Do you have a good grasp of your identity?

Verse of the Day

‘So God created human beings in his own image. In the image of God he created them; male and female he created them.’

Genesis 1:27

Today’s Devotional

We are going to spend some time digging into what the Bible actually says about our identity.  Who are you?  Who am I?

It is my belief that if I can truly grasp who God says I am, then I will be able to receive God’s unending love for me.  And as I am continually filled with God’s love, it will spill out of my life as God’s love changes me from the inside out.  My identity is not my name, what I look like, how much money I have, what country I live in, or anything that can be seen on the surface.

Looking back at today’s verse, it says that I am made in God’s image.  So are you.  All human beings bear the image of the creator God.

I have no idea what God looks like.  But I believe what the Bible says.  I have no idea how, specifically, we bear the image of God.  

People who know me and who know my biological daughter say that we look a lot alike.  I don’t see it.  But other people seem to see it.  Some people say she also really resembles her aunts on my husband’s side of the family.  No matter who she resembles, you can look at her and have no doubt that she is our daughter.  That’s what God sees when He looks at us.  To him, there is no doubt that we are His.  He made us, we resemble Him in ways we probably cannot see or understand.

Each of us is created and formed by a God that CHOSE to make us in His image.  For today, let’s allow that truth to be a reminder of his love.
